About Daniel A. Kuppers

Daniel A. Kuppers is a scholar working on Oncology, Virology and Epidemiology, having authored 13 papers that have together received 610 indexed citations. Recurring topics across this work include Viral-associated cancers and disorders (5 papers), Cytomegalovirus and herpesvirus research (5 papers) and Herpesvirus Infections and Treatments (4 papers). The work is most often cited by research in Oncology (442 citations), Epidemiology (358 citations) and Virology (30 citations). Daniel A. Kuppers has collaborated with scholars based in United States, South Africa and Canada. Frequent co-authors include Ke Lan, Erle S. Robertson, Subhash C. Verma, Masanao Murakami, Nikhil Sharma, Tathagata Choudhuri, Patrick J. Paddison, Jason S. Knight, Lucas Carter and Housheng Hansen He. Their work appears in journals such as Nature Communications, PLoS ONE and Journal of Virology.
